Flawless
Production: United Kingdom, Luxembourg, United States of America
Release date: 2007-09-01
A female executive and a night janitor conspire to commit a daring diamond heist from their mutual employer, The London Diamond Corporation.
6.2
5.1
7
4.4
0
6.1
6.6
6.9
7.4
6.8
© CeCe. All rights reserved.